Output 51a29899269a79f514320ff279cca791e30c94775582550d03f0446491a3ca08:0

value
398803740
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86d8ffafc81cbadb27a701ffc89d0fa3d08ee26d OP_EQUALVERIFY OP_CHECKSIG
address
1DJ1W3aszNPbK8pDaydcGppyTy2v8pcJos
transaction
51a29899269a79f514320ff279cca791e30c94775582550d03f0446491a3ca08
spent
true